Wilma's Loss

In 1932, Wilma McClatchie faces the heartbreak of losing her boyfriend. Struggling with the grief, she decides to take charge of his bootlegging operation, marking a significant turning point in her life.

Bootlegging Operations Begin

Wilma, along with her two daughters, Polly and Billie Jean, embarks on the challenging journey of running the bootlegging operation. They navigate through treacherous routes, dealing with the constant threat of being discovered by authorities.

Authorities Catch On

As Wilma and her daughters continue their illegal activities, local authorities begin to suspect their operations. The family's initial thrill turns to anxiety as they negotiate terms to escape potential capture.

The Bank Heist

In a bid to further their criminal enterprise, Wilma attempts to cash a counterfeit check at a bank. The atmosphere quickly degenerates into chaos as Fred Diller and his gang storm the bank, seizing control and creating a dangerous situation.

Fleeing the Scene

Amidst the turbulence of the bank heist, Wilma and her daughters seize the opportunity to grab money bags. However, their getaway is thwarted when Diller commandeers their vehicle, leaving them at his mercy.

Unexpected Romance

As Wilma and Diller begin navigating their perilous lifestyle together, an unexpected bond forms between them. What begins as a partnership evolves into a passionate affair that complicates their lives even further.

Engaging in Scams

Together, Wilma and Diller embark on a variety of scams, boosting their profits with each venture. Each successful con brings them closer together while also intensifying the dangers they face.

The Gambler Enters the Scene

During one of their escapades, Wilma encounters William J. Baxter, a charming but deceitful gambler. His romantic interest in Wilma complicates their operations and adds tension within the group.

Kidnapping the Tycoon's Daughter

In a bold yet reckless move, Wilma's gang kidnaps a wealthy tycoon's daughter, intending to demand a hefty ransom. This dangerous act elevates the stakes and brings unwanted attention from law enforcement.

Federal Agents Close In

As Wilma's gang continues their criminal activities, federal agents begin tracking their every move. Their growing notoriety puts them at risk as law enforcement gathers evidence against them.

Baxter's Capture

In a twist of fate, Baxter is captured by the authorities, jeopardizing Wilma and her daughters. His capture reveals the informant role he had, which complicates their escape plans.

The Great Getaway

Amidst the escalating tension, Wilma, Polly, and Billie Jean make a daring escape with a suitcase full of money. Diller provides cover using his Tommy gun, creating a chaotic scene of violence.

Baxter's Tragic Fate

In a heartbreaking moment, Diller's actions lead to the death of Baxter, who had been secretly aiding the law. His sacrifice reveals the extent of betrayal woven into their tumultuous lives.

Escape into the Sunset

As Wilma's bloodied arm dangles outside their fleeing vehicle, the trio races into the vast Texas landscape. Their fates are forever interconnected in this dangerous dance of crime and survival.
